Browse editions

Current edition

552 pages 1928

fiction classics challenging reflective slow-paced
Other editions (29)
Expand filter menu Filter editions

438 pages paperback 1928

fiction classics challenging reflective slow-paced

441 pages paperback 1928

fiction classics challenging reflective slow-paced

616 pages paperback 1928

fiction classics challenging reflective slow-paced

441 pages paperback 1928

fiction classics challenging reflective slow-paced

556 pages digital 1928

fiction classics challenging reflective slow-paced

694 pages paperback 1928

fiction classics challenging reflective slow-paced

608 pages paperback 1928

fiction classics challenging reflective slow-paced

538 pages paperback 1928

fiction classics challenging reflective slow-paced

531 pages 1928

fiction classics challenging reflective slow-paced

601 pages hardcover 1928 user-added

fiction classics challenging reflective slow-paced